Address

ecash:qzv3w9axsxg8pgv7hh94q624ms54pyscucwg54c88lCopy

Total Received

15392148.99 XEC

Total Sent

15392148.99 XEC

№ Transactions

149

Final Balance

0 XEC

Transactions
Filter